Advanced Multi-Geometry CNC Milling Services
We overcome the challenges of intricate geometries and rigorous tolerances by utilizing advanced 3-axis, 4-axis, and 5-axis CNC milling centers configured to expertly machine challenging materials including titanium, high-strength aluminum, and engineering plastics. By optimizing multi-axis toolpaths and consolidating operations, we eliminate production bottlenecks and secondary processing errors to deliver complex structural components with flawless geometric fidelity. This advanced manufacturing process is fully governed by our strict IATF 16949 quality framework, guaranteeing micron-level precision controlled repeatability from initial prototyping through high-volume production runs.

2. Comprehensive Secondary Finishing
Medical-Grade Finishes: Expert passivation and electropolishing ensuring strict biocompatibility compliance.
Advanced Coatings: Hard anodizing and specialized treatments maximizing wear resistance for robotics.
Precision Heat Treatment: Strategic material hardening fulfilling exacting mechanical stress and durability requirements.

3. Complex Sub-Assembly Integration
Hardware Insertion: Expert precision installation of Helicoils, threaded inserts, and custom alignment pins.
Cleanroom Processing: Controlled environment assembly and secure packaging safeguarding sensitive medical components.
Turnkey Modules: Delivering ready-to-integrate mechanical sub-assemblies to streamline your final production lines.

4. Stringent Traceability & Compliance
Full Traceability: Complete heat lot tracking and material certification from raw billet to final part.
Regulatory Documentation: Comprehensive PPAP, FAI, and quality reporting tailored for strictly regulated industries.
Lean Supply Solutions: Vendor Managed Inventory (VMI) and Kanban systems synchronizing with your production schedules.
